I love my .30-06. It's all the rifle I'll ever need for hunting. It's about the most rifle I'd ever use for deer, and it'll certainly do the trick on elk, caribou and even moose. There is a good reason the .30-06 has been in the top 5 cartridges for sales for the last 101 years straight, and it's unlikely, barring a major breakthrough in small arms techknowlogy, that it'll become obsolete no matter how many "short-ultra-super-boomer" magnums come out.
